New G.I. Bill - NOT YET!!! Published July 15, 2008 By Education and Training Center staff MALMSTROM AIR FORCE BASE, Mont. -- Many have heard that President Bush recently signed the Bill for a new and different GI Bill (referred to as Ch. 33). The news reports and excited speculation have created an onslaught of premature business to Education & Training Centers Air Force-wide. At this time, Education Officers are NOT authorized to allow transfer of benefits, change from Ch. 30 to Ch. 33, request refund of $1,200, or any other action related to the new Bill. The program will not be implemented until next year, perhaps as late as August 2009. DoD and Air Staff must first establish policy and procedures, configure computers and design forms, and provide guidance and training to customer service personnel.
